你查询的IP:[123.206.135.138]  地理位置:中国–上海–上海

最新查询222.248.184.126 202.130.183.184 116.252.253.249 121.255.173.179 124.172.123.199 119.253.100.144 123.103.48.52 203.212.163.108 125.215.34.48 123.206.135.138 124.250.123.208 116.244.13.4 119.63.32.56 60.235.253.23 220.248.32.178 202.91.128.218 203.132.32.123 202.4.128.130 219.242.29.21 118.112.201.199 118.248.237.112 117.59.113.17 58.30.230.136 119.31.192.80 202.90.169.144 118.89.157.39 221.13.156.45 202.90.224.34 203.90.163.93 203.212.106.176 117.48.192.7